BBC WIll Have To Share Licence Fee With Rival Broadcaster
News Hardware
Bringing the BBC's 87-year old monopoly over the licence fee to an end, the UK government in its much-hyped Digital Britain report spelled out that it will take portion of the licence fee to help fund local and regional news on ITV.
